About Converting Short tons per Square Kilometer to Milligrams per Hectare
Short ton per Square Kilometer and Milligram per Hectare both measure a farming-related quantity — a land area or an application/yield rate per unit area — used to report crop yields, calculate how much fertilizer or seed a field needs, and plan irrigation. Both are mass application rate units.
Formula
milligrams per hectare = short tons per square kilometer × 9071847.4
This factor comes from each unit's defined relationship to the category's base unit: 1 short ton per square kilometer equals 0.00090718474 base units, and 1 milligram per hectare equals 1e-10 base units, so dividing one by the other gives the direct short ton per square kilometer-to-milligram per hectare factor of 9071847.4.
Simple example
1 ton/km2 × 9071847.4 = 9,071,847.4 mg/ha
1 short ton per square kilometer = 9,071,847.4 milligrams per hectare.
Real-world example
100 ton/km2 × 9071847.4 = 907,184,740 mg/ha
100 short tons per square kilometer = 907,184,740 milligrams per hectare.

What's the difference between a yield rate and an application rate?
A yield rate describes how much of a crop is harvested per unit of land area (for example, tonnes per hectare). An application rate describes how much of an input like fertilizer or seed is applied per unit of land area. Both are commonly expressed using the same kind of mass-per-area units.
